Remember how I talked yesterday about Manny Ramirez's presence was instantly adding a shot of life to the arm of an otherwise fairly docile clubhouse? Well, as I entered the room this morning, Manny wasn't around, but his iPod deck was in full swing, playing a Spanish version of a rap song I recognized but can't remember the title (and I think it might be unprintable, anyway). Not ten second pass before my ears were filled with the sounds of Angel Berroa singing along with the tune. Safe to say, I'd never hear the Dodger shortstop belt one out before #99 hit town. But even former Rookie of the Year's need creative outlets, too. Perhaps Mr. Berroa will now feel free to continue letting his freak flag fly.
Of course, that could be contingent on Manny being allowed to keep his airborne. As far as the new locker room tunes go, assuming it's not the beginning of a musical romper room, Joe Torre is taking no issue. "if everybody's okay with listening to something, fine. I don't want seven different things going on at the same time, and if that's a problem, plug in (the ear phones)." Incidentally, over the years, Torre's only had one player whose musical tastes rubbed him the wrong way. That would be David Wells. "On the day he pitched, he played this obnoxious music. But my feeling is, if nobody objects for that one day, if you feel it helps you..."
Manny's other form of self expression- a head full of dreadlocks- remain for the time being in full effect despite Torre's request for a trim. Of course, Manny's also been in L.A. barely 48 hours, which is why Torre isn't taking this yet as defiance on his left fielder's part. Ramirez said he'd take care of the matter, and Torre's willing to let a few days or so pass before reminding him again.
Other Notes
Jonathon Broxton is fine, according to Torre. He's sore (the reason why he didn't enter last night's game in the ninth), but that's the result of throwing in the pen nine days in a row.
Brad Penny will throw another BP session and is still scheduled to pitch Friday in SF. He'll meet up with the team in St. Louis at some point. Scott Proctor, however, won't travel and was very sore after yesterday's rehab appearance. Another one is in order before entertaining any thoughts of Proctor rejoining the big club.
For now, no plans for sending Andruw Jones to the Minors are in place.

As is my understanding, Manny couldn't have 24 (Alston, retired) and his next choice was 34, which isn't retired but I think was nixed out of respect for Fernando. From there, 99 came up through some suggestions tossed out. Manny himself seems somewhere between cool and indifferent to it. He also liked "30," since that was the number on a Dodger uni he had as a little kid. It's Blake's number and he said he'd give it to Manny if he wanted it, but I guess Manny said not to worry.
